Frequently Asked Questions

What is the difference between a harness and a lanyard?

A harness is a full-body piece of equipment that distributes the force of a fall, while a lanyard connects the harness to an anchor point.

How often should fall protection equipment be inspected?

It should be inspected regularly, ideally before each use, to ensure it remains in good condition.

  • Respiratory Fit Testing : Respiratory Fit Testing services are available at your location or ours. SIIPL’s offers both Qualitative and Quantitative Fit Testing methods. Proper mask fit is crucial in minimizing risk to contaminate on the job. All personnel who have the potential to be exposed to contaminate are required to have fit testing performed on an annual basis in compliance with OSHA and MSHA regulations.
    Qualitative Fit Testing is performed when using half mask respirators and relies on the senses of taste and smell or reaction to an irritant to determine leakage.
    Quantitative Fit Testing can be used for any type of respirator and is performed using a machine to determine the actual leakage into the face piece.
    All persons who are scheduled to have fit testing performed must be medically evaluated prior to the test date to ensure the attendee is medically able to wear the respirator. In addition, all attendees must be clean shaven in order undergo testing.

Hazop

A structured and systematic method for identifying potential hazards and operability problems in complex systems, such as a chemical plant or oil refinery. It is a form of Process Hazard Analysis that helps organizations proactively identify risks before an incident occurs by examining how a process can deviate from its design intent.

Ergonomics Assessment

A professional evaluation of a worker's workstation and job tasks to identify risks for injury and discomfort with a goal to make adjustments to the work setup, equipment, or tasks to reduce physical hazards like awkward postures, repetitive motions, and forceful movements, thereby improving comfort, safety, productivity, and well-being

  • Observation: A professional observes how an individual works, sits, and interacts with their environment.
  • Evaluation : The assessor evaluates factors like workstation setup (desk, chair, monitor height), posture, repetitive movements, and force used in the job.
  • Information Gathering : Questions may be asked about daily tasks, previous injuries, and individual characteristics to understand the current situation.
  • Risk identification : The assessment identifies potential risk factors that could lead to musculoskeletal disorders (MSDs), such as carpal tunnel syndrome or back pain.
  • Recommendations : Based on the findings, recommendations are provided for adjustments or new equipment to improve the work environment.

Indoor Air Quality Program

Indoor Air Quality (IAQ) may be the edge between productive & unproductive manpower for any Organization. Emphasis on IAQ is increasing in a highly competitive and challenging business environment. We offer IAQ services for the physical, chemical and biological characteristics of air inside a building or any commercial facility. Poor IAQ may cause workers, occupants and even the
Visiting public to experience a range of non-specific symptoms that affect their comfort or health. These symptoms collectively known as sick building syndrome which includes headache, fatigue, nausea, eye or nose or throat irritation, shortness of breath etc.

  • Monitoring & Analysis for various Physical, chemical, Aerosols & Microbiological Pollutants/Hazards like Temperature, RH, CO2, CO, O2, TVOC, PM10, PM2.5, TBC, TFC, etc. as per requirement, for controlled closed Air Conditioned office facilities like MNC´s, Software industries, Hotels, Call Centers, Hospitals, etc.
  • Survey of the Building including AHU & Air conditioning systems and surrounding area of the building to identify source/ cause of problem, if any

Industrial (Occupational) Hygiene is science dedicated to the anticipation, recognition, evaluation, communication and control of environmental stressors in, or arising from, the workplace that may result in injury, illness, impairment, or affect the wellbeing of workers and members of the community.
These stressors are divided into different categories e.g. Biological, Chemical, Physical, Ergonomic and Psychosocial. Industrial Hygiene services offered by us are :
